2020 Blacktail
Easy to follow process
Step 1 - Shoot the deer
Step 2 - Cut off and skin the head
Step 3 - Bury the head in the garden for five months
Step 4 - Dig it up and hose it off
Step 5 - Hang it in the barn with the others

Place skull in pot, bring water and some powdered detergent to a light boil. Once the flesh starts loosening put on rain gear, and hit it with a pressure washer. Quickest and easiest way I’ve come across. Next day use some volume 40 or 50 and it’ll turn perfectly white. I’ve probably done 30-40 this way.

I didn't dig out the brains, eyeballs or even remove the tongue or lower jaw - just took off the hide and put it in the hole.
I've got very rich soil with a whole bunch of different ground critters that seem to eat everything but the fat which washes right off with the garden hose. No scrubbing, scraping or cutting. The brain cavity was clean as a whistle but some chunks of stuff did come out of the nasal opening when I hosed it off. All the thin little bones in the nose are intact.
This isn't how I'd do it if I was going to display it in the house. The bucks and bull that I have in the house were beetle cleaned, decreased and whitened by taxidermist. When I do it this way they look more like you found them in the woods which is a look i also like.
